From 9f00cdd71213df6fb057f3ae4b5704b9272be6b6 Mon Sep 17 00:00:00 2001 From: Rui_Li <877258667@qq.com> Date: Tue, 15 Feb 2022 18:10:25 +0800 Subject: [PATCH] =?UTF-8?q?=E6=9D=90=E6=96=99=E4=B8=8B=E6=96=99?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../yieldReport/com_cutting_material.vue | 41 +++---------------- 1 file changed, 6 insertions(+), 35 deletions(-) diff --git a/src/views/modules/yieldReport/com_cutting_material.vue b/src/views/modules/yieldReport/com_cutting_material.vue index 8d24b67..c756a09 100644 --- a/src/views/modules/yieldReport/com_cutting_material.vue +++ b/src/views/modules/yieldReport/com_cutting_material.vue @@ -35,7 +35,7 @@ - 确定 + 确定 关闭 @@ -143,7 +143,8 @@ export default { let transQty = this.pageData.transQty; //判断是否可以修改 if (transQty > this.pageData.oriTransQty){ - this.$message.error('!'); + this.$message.error('退料数量超过了该记录上的发料数量!'); + return false; } //判断时间是否在范围之内 if(transQty <= 0){ @@ -151,40 +152,10 @@ export default { } }, - /*获取BOM行号*/ - refreshSomItemNos(){ - getBomItemNosByPartNo(this.pageData).then(({data}) => { - //判断是否成功 - if(data.code == 500){ - this.$message.error(data.msg); - return false; - } - this.bomList = data.rows; - //首先判断行号是否只有一行 - if(this.bomList.length == 1){ - //禁用下拉框 - this.selectFlag = true; - //选中第一个 - this.pageData.bomItemNo = data.rows[0].itemNo; - }else{ - //启用下拉框 - this.selectFlag = false; - } - }); - }, - - /*保存材料上机的记录*/ - feedingMaterialRollFun(){ + /*处理材料下料的记录*/ + processCuttingMaterial(){ //判断卷号是否为空 - if (this.pageData.rmRollNo == null || this.pageData.rmRollNo == ''){ - this.$message.error('请扫描材料卷号!') - return false; - } - //判断是否选中行号 - if(this.pageData.bomItemNo == '请选择' || this.pageData.bomItemNo === ''){ - this.$message.error('请选择BOM行号!') - return false; - } + //调用方法执行上材料 feedingMaterialRoll(this.pageData).then(({data}) => { if(data.code == 500){